Britain moves to ban dog and cat fur

 

It's reported the trade in dog and cat fur is to be banned in the UK.

 

The move comes following a two-year campaign by the RSPCA which used 101

Dalmatians and 102 Dalmatians to promote the issue.

 

The fur is imported from China.

 

A Foreign Office official told The Sunday Telegraph: " This is a Government

commitment to ban the importation and selling of dog and cat fur.

 

" The law will have to be changed to bring about a ban, which could be on the

statue book by September 2002. Measures that could be taken to enforce it could

include DNA checks on fur on sale. "

 

An RSPCA spokesman said: " There is no doubt that cat and dog fur is used in

clothing on sale in the high street and we welcome all moves to stop this

trade. "

 

The paper reports how recently a fur coat collar from a leading store in

London's West End, not named for legal reasons, was found to contain dog fur.

 

Story filed: 10:00 Sunday 23rd December 2001
